Pretty technical video for you guys this episode, please please please get a copy of the repair manual before attempting jobs like this. I go in and perform a repair for a known issue with these FA20 engines. For whatever reason these cam sprockets start to cause issues and throws cam/crank correlation codes. So I filmed and talked about the process of changing out these cam gears. It’s worth mentioning that other brands have had many issues with these variable valve timing gears since they’ve come into production. It’s nice to be able to have dynamic valve timing but it definitely comes at a cost when it needs to be repaired.

  • @dariusmolfetas941

    @dariusmolfetas941

    Ай бұрын

    If the gear you bought says EXH on it then you have an exhaust cam gear. Intakes will say INT-RH/LH MPL on the face of the gear and have a MPL on the backside where the camshaft bolts in. Exhaust cam gears say EXH-RH/LH on the face of the gear and EXH on the backside.

  • @SkillCollectors

    @SkillCollectors

    Жыл бұрын

    Can’t say for certain what your problem is exactly but most of the time if it’s not the sensor or solenoid then it’s going to be that VVT cam gear. There’s a technical service bulletin out from Subaru for this problem that goes through this in detail. static.nhtsa.gov/odi/tsbs/2019/MC-10160490-9999.pdf
